Spending Your Vacation on Your Bike

Many people take a week or even two weeks? vacation every year.  Some people take their entire family with them on vacation, but bikers sometimes talk their spouses into letting them spend a week on the road with their biker buddies.  Of course, if you and your spouse both ride and don't have children, you can take a biker vacation whenever you want!  Either way, if you're thinking about spending your vacation on your bike traveling, there are some things you need to plan out.

The first think is your schedule.  While you need to do this with any trip, it's especially important to do so on a bike.  It's also especially important to make sure your schedule is flexible.  With a car, for example, it's possible to continue traveling in the rain, although you will want to drive more slowly.  On a bike, though, it can be impossible to keep going in a heavy downpour.

You also need to take into account how much luggage you'll be taking with you and how many things you'll want to buy along the way.  This is especially important if you have fairly small saddlebags.  If you pull a trailer behind your bike, it's not quite as important to pack lightly.  When making purchases on the road, remember that you don't have a trunk or backseat like you would in a car.  You can always purchase items and mail them back, but the postage can quickly add up.  That's an extra expense that you might not be able to fit into your budget.

Naturally, before you leave, you'll want to get your bike checked out.  Get the tired checked and maybe even change the oil before you head out just to make certain you don't break down on your trip.
